The MAX18066/MAX18166 current-mode, synchronous,
DC-DC buck converters deliver an output current up
to 4A with high efficiency. The devices operate from
an input voltage of 4.5V to 16V and provides an
adjustable output voltage from 0.606V to 90% of the
input voltage. The devices are ideal for distributed power
systems, notebook computers, nonportable consumer
applications, and preregulation applications.

The devices feature a PWM mode operation with
an internally fixed switching frequency of 500kHz
(MAX18066) and 350kHz (MAX18166) capable of 90%
maximum duty cycle. The devices automatically enter
skip mode at light loads. The current-mode control
architecture simplifies compensation design and ensures
a cycle-by-cycle current limit and fast response to line
and load transients. A high-gain transconductance error
amplifier allows flexibility in setting the external com-
pensation, simplifying the design and allowing for an all-
ceramic design.

The synchronous buck regulators feature inter-
nal MOSFETs that provide better efficiency than
asynchronous solutions, while simplifying the design
relative to discrete controller solutions. In addition to
simplifying the design, the integrated MOSFETs minimize
EMI, reduce board space, and provide higher reliability by
minimizing the number of external components.

Additional features include an externally adjustable
soft-start, independent enable input and power-good
output for power sequencing, and thermal shutdown
protection. The devices offer overcurrent protection (high-
side sourcing) with hiccup mode during an output short-
circuit condition. The devices ensure safe startup when
powering into a prebiased output.

The MAX18066/MAX18166 are available in a 2mm x
2mm, 16-bump (4 x 4 array), 0.5mm pitch wafer-level
package (WLP) and are fully specified from -40°C to
+85°C.
